git把分支变成master

以下操作在确定不再使用master代码才进行,或者备份一份原master

假设需要变成主分支的分支名称为 branch1

1.到git的setting页面,把默认分支暂时替换为其他分支,如 branch1,一般在仓库管理中的分支管理里可以设置
2.在本地切换到其他分支,不能在master

 git checkout branch1

3.删除本地及远程master分支

git branch -D master    //删除本地master分支
git push origin --delete master   //删除远程master分支

4.新建本地master分支,然后切换到master分支

git checkout -b master

5.把本地master分支推送到远程

git push origin master:master

6.再把默认分支切换为maser

你可能感兴趣的:(笔记,github,git,github)